The garage occupancy feed for the Brindlewood campus arrives over a message queue every thirty seconds, one record per level, published by the Stallgrid edge boxes. Counts can briefly go negative when a sensor double-fires on exit; the ingest job clamps these to zero and flags the interval. If the feed stalls for more than five minutes, the dashboard falls back to the last known snapshot. Sensor mappings, queue names, and the replay procedure are documented on the internal page below.

runbook for tahog-kadug: https://gitlab.qirvanworks.corp/projects/pages/view/b139298aed28

Pennywhistle reset flow, v2. Token TTL dropped to 10 min. Old emails route through the legacy template until Q3. If resets stall, check the Mallard queue depth first, then the hasher pool. Never re-enable the v1 endpoint; it bypasses lockout. Verify you're on the patched release, noted below.

trace token, kawip-fafog: htk14_26e64c4d35154e

# Idempotency Keys: Limits & Quotas

Payment retries on the Tollgate gateway must reuse the original idempotency key. Keys are scoped per merchant account, expire after the retention window, and duplicate submissions past the rate cap are rejected outright. Reviewers: verify handlers never mint a fresh key on retry. Current limits are as follows.

constants for hahof-bajep:
THRESHOLDS = {
    "sorwyn": 797,
    "jorath": 933,
    "pramir": 998,
    "wenath": 950,
    "silok": 489,
    "prawyn": 572,
    "praiel": 821,
}

Changelog — Gatewing API Gateway v2.14

Added per-tenant rate limiting at the edge. Limits now read from the Quotari config service instead of hardcoded values; changes apply within 60 seconds, no redeploy. Default: 500 req/min per tenant, burst 100. 429 responses include a retry-after header. Shadow mode ran for two weeks on the Veldmark cluster with zero false throttles. Dashboards updated. Legacy limiter removed in v2.15. Questions or rollback requests go to the engineer named below.

approver of faduf-bagug = Framir Sorwyn